Common use of Cooperation; Resources Clause in Contracts

Cooperation; Resources. (a) Subject to the terms and conditions set forth in this Agreement, Hxxxxx and the Company shall use good faith efforts to cooperate with each other in all matters relating to the provision and receipt of Services. Such good faith cooperation shall include, subject to Section 5.01, (i) exchanging information reasonably requested by the other party (including such information reasonably requested in connection with any internal or external audit, whether in the United States or any other country); (ii) providing electronic access to data systems used in connection with the Services; (iii) performing true-ups and adjustments; and (iv) making available, as reasonably requested by the other party, timely decisions, approvals and acceptances, and obtaining all consents, licenses, sublicenses or approvals necessary or desirable in order to permit each party to perform its obligations under this Agreement in a timely and efficient manner. The Company shall use reasonable best efforts to provide information and documentation sufficient for Hxxxxx to satisfy its obligations under this Agreement. In connection with the Services, the Company shall make reasonably available for consultation with Hxxxxx those employees and consultants or other service providers of the Company reasonably necessary for the effective provision by Hxxxxx of such Services.
